ALPENA – The Alpena boy’s basketball team won in convincing fashion, 87-38, over the Onaway Cardinals at the Thunder Bay Junior High in Alpena on Saturday.
The Wildcats ended their regular season on a high note and the win sets the stage for playoff action which begins tonight against Petoskey, in Petoskey.
Every Alpena player got playing time, and each one got their name in the scoring column.
Bryton Nostrandt led the way with 20 points, and CJ Havermahl had 13 points. Evan Hahn contributed 10 points, Kai Peterson and Wyatt Srebnik added nine points each. Chase Coulon scored eight points.
Alpena Head Coach Evan Neff said he was pleased with his team’s effort in its last game of the regular season.
“It was really good to get everyone some time on the floor; I thought we did some pretty good things,” Neff said.
Now the focus for Neff and the Wildcats shifts to playoff basketball.
“We had a really good practice yesterday and this was really in preparation for both Petoskey, and moving forward, getting our young guys reps and I was happy to get a twentieth game in,” Neff added.
